Maren and her girlfriend Kaia set out to rescue Sev and free the dragons from the corrupt emperor in the explosive finale to the journey that began with Shatter the Sky.
Let them burn.

Maren's world was shattered when her girlfriend, Kaia, was abducted by the Aurati. After a daring rescue, they've finally been reunited, but Maren's life is still in pieces: Kaia seems more like a stranger than the lover Maren knew back home; Naava, the mother of all dragons, has retreated into seclusion to recover from her wounds, leaving Maren at a loss for how to set the rest of the dragons free; and worst of all, her friend Sev has been captured by the emperor's Talons.

As a prisoner of Zefed, Sev finds himself entangled in a treacherous game of court politics. With more people joining the rebellion, whispers of a rogue dragon mistress spreading, and escape seeming less likely with each passing day, Sev knows that it won't be long before the emperor decides to make an example of him. If he's to survive, he'll have to strike first—or hope Maren reaches him in time.

With the final battle for Zefed looming, Maren must set aside her fears, draw upon all she's learned about her dragon-touched abilities, and face her destiny once and for all. But when the fighting is over and the smoke clears, who will be left standing?

      Gr 8 Up-Picking up where Shatter the Sky left off, Maren ben Gao continues to flee in an attempt to free the dragons and reunite with Kaia who was abducted by the Aurati. Maren faces even more challenges in this sequel. Naava, the mother of all dragons, is in hiding making it difficult to free the dragons, Kaia, her girlfriend, is distant upon being released, and Maren's good friend and helper, Sev, has been captured by the emporer's Talons. Plenty of action and battles ensue as Maren hopes to be triumphant among the politics involving Sev's situation. With time running out Maren must find the courage to step outside her comfort zone to save Sev and free the dragons in a powerful empire. The plot moves at a satisfying pace and the dragon's play an important role with the author making it clear when the dragons are communicating. Maren continues to be a strong female character who learns plenty along the way. Kaia and Maren's romance is not as pronounced in this novel as the first as Maren has her mind on Sev as well. The ending gives the reader closure but leaves the romance open-ended. VERDICT Readers will want to have read the first book in order to appreciate this finale; a good purchase for book collections looking for LGBTQ romance.-Karen Alexander, Lake Fenton H.S., Linden, MI
